ooopppx 发表于 2014-5-15 11:37:55

求助winIIS7.5下PHP客户端发送email的的配置问题

本帖最后由 ooopppx 于 2014-5-15 11:39 编辑

win2008SR2IIS7.5
PHP5.3
AWS(已开端口25、465)
下面是配置

php.ini
SMTP = smtp.ym.163.com
smtp_port = 25
sendmail_from =
sendmail_path = "D:\sendmail\sendmail.exe -t"sendmail.inismtp_server=smtp.ym.163.com
smtp_port=25
smtp_ssl=auto
error_logfile=error.log
debug_logfile=debug.log
auth_username=
auth_password=


test.php<?php
$mail = “[email protected]”;
$subject = “Mail Test”;
$text = “This is a test mail for function mail()”;if(mail($mail,$subject,$text)){
echo “email send success!”;
}else{
echo “email send fail!”;
}
?>
现在的问题是测试返回suceess!但邮件死活收不到,且sendmail根目录下未生成error和debug日志


河小马 发表于 2014-5-15 23:54:59

sendmail 配置不正确

先把sendmail 配置好了,然后看log
页: [1]
查看完整版本: 求助winIIS7.5下PHP客户端发送email的的配置问题